编程游戏一般用什么软件

不及物动词 其他 20

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程游戏一般使用的软件主要有以下几种:

    1. 游戏引擎:游戏引擎是一个开发游戏的软件框架,它提供了一系列的工具和功能,用于创建、渲染和管理游戏。常见的游戏引擎包括Unity和Unreal Engine。Unity是一个跨平台的游戏引擎,支持多种平台,包括PC、移动设备、主机等。Unreal Engine则是一个功能强大的游戏引擎,广泛应用于AAA级游戏的开发。

    2. 编程语言:编程游戏需要使用编程语言来编写游戏逻辑和算法。常用的编程语言有C++、C#、Java、Python等。C++是一种高性能的编程语言,常用于游戏引擎和游戏开发。C#是一种面向对象的编程语言,常用于Unity游戏开发。Java是一种跨平台的编程语言,常用于Android游戏开发。Python是一种简单易学的编程语言,适用于快速原型开发和小型游戏开发。

    3. 图形编辑软件:游戏中的角色、场景和特效通常需要使用图形编辑软件进行设计和制作。常见的图形编辑软件有Photoshop、Maya、3ds Max等。Photoshop是一款流行的图像处理软件,用于创建游戏中的贴图和UI界面。Maya和3ds Max是专业的三维建模和动画软件,常用于制作游戏中的角色和场景。

    4. 物理引擎:物理引擎是用于模拟游戏中物体的物理行为和碰撞效果的软件组件。常见的物理引擎有Box2D和PhysX。Box2D是一个开源的二维物理引擎,适用于2D游戏开发。PhysX是NVIDIA开发的一款高性能的物理引擎,适用于3D游戏开发。

    综上所述,编程游戏一般使用的软件包括游戏引擎、编程语言、图形编辑软件和物理引擎等。通过这些软件的组合,开发者可以创建出丰富多样的游戏内容。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程游戏通常使用以下软件:

    1. 游戏引擎:游戏引擎是开发游戏的核心软件。它提供了一系列工具和功能,帮助开发人员创建、设计和实现游戏。常见的游戏引擎包括Unity和Unreal Engine。

    2. 集成开发环境(IDE):IDE是一种软件,集成了编写、调试和测试代码的工具。它提供了代码编辑器、编译器和调试器等功能,方便开发人员编写和管理代码。常见的游戏开发IDE包括Visual Studio和Xcode。

    3. 图形设计软件:图形设计软件用于创建游戏中的角色、场景和特效等图形元素。常见的图形设计软件包括Adobe Photoshop和Pixlr。

    4. 建模和动画软件:建模和动画软件用于创建游戏中的3D模型和动画。它们允许开发人员创建和编辑角色、道具和环境等3D元素。常见的建模和动画软件包括Blender和Autodesk Maya。

    5. 物理引擎:物理引擎是一种用于模拟和处理游戏中物体的物理行为的软件库。它可以计算碰撞、重力、摩擦等物理效果,使游戏更加真实和可交互。常见的物理引擎包括Box2D和PhysX。

    这些软件通常在游戏开发中使用,但具体的选择取决于开发人员的需求和偏好。一些开发人员可能会使用不同的工具和软件来开发不同类型的游戏。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程游戏通常使用以下软件:

    1. 游戏引擎:游戏引擎是开发游戏的核心工具。它提供了一系列的开发工具和功能,用于创建、组装和管理游戏的各个方面,包括图形渲染、物理模拟、碰撞检测、音频处理等。常见的游戏引擎有Unity、Unreal Engine、Cocos2d等。这些引擎提供了直观易用的界面和功能,使开发者能够快速创建游戏。

    2. 集成开发环境(IDE):IDE是用于编写、调试和测试代码的软件工具。它提供了代码编辑器、编译器、调试器等功能,能够大大提高开发效率。常见的游戏开发IDE有Visual Studio、Xcode、Eclipse等。这些IDE提供了丰富的代码编辑和调试功能,帮助开发者快速定位和解决问题。

    3. 图形设计软件:游戏中的图形元素通常需要使用专业的图形设计软件进行制作和编辑。常见的图形设计软件有Photoshop、Illustrator、GIMP等。这些软件提供了强大的绘图和图像处理功能,使开发者能够创建精美的游戏画面和角色。

    4. 声音编辑软件:游戏中的音效和音乐需要使用声音编辑软件进行制作和编辑。常见的声音编辑软件有Audacity、Adobe Audition等。这些软件提供了强大的音频处理和编辑功能,使开发者能够创建逼真的游戏音效和音乐。

    5. 物理模拟软件:一些高级的游戏可能需要进行物理模拟,以实现真实的物理效果。常见的物理模拟软件有PhysicsJS、Box2D等。这些软件提供了物体运动和碰撞检测等功能,使开发者能够实现真实的物理效果。

    总结:编程游戏通常需要使用游戏引擎、集成开发环境、图形设计软件、声音编辑软件和物理模拟软件等工具。这些软件提供了丰富的功能和工具,帮助开发者创建出丰富多样的游戏体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部